Understanding the 50/30/20 Rule

Before we dive into the nitty-gritty of identifying hidden values, it's essential to grasp the 50/30/20 rule. This straightforward guideline dictates that 50% of your income should go towards necessary expenses like rent, utilities, and groceries. A further 30% should be allocated towards discretionary spending – think entertainment, hobbies, and travel. And finally, 20% should be set aside for saving and debt repayment. By following this rule, you'll be well on your way to creating a solid foundation for your financial planning.

Scouring Your Everyday Expenses for Hidden Value

Hidden value can be hiding in plain sight, and it comes in many forms. Take, for instance, unused rewards points or cashback on your credit cards. You might also have discounts or coupons on everyday items that can be put to good use. And then there are refundable deposits on services like gym memberships or streaming platforms – these can be redeemed for a nice little boost to your savings.

Let's say you have a credit card that offers 2% cashback on all purchases. By paying for your everyday expenses with that card, you can earn a significant amount of money over time. And if you've got unused rewards points or travel miles, you can redeem them for flights or accommodations. It's a simple way to turn your everyday expenses into a valuable resource.

Supercharging Your Savings

Once you've identified the hidden value in your everyday expenses, it's time to maximize your savings. Here are a few strategies to consider:

Set up automatic transfers to a savings account, so you can watch your money grow over time. Create a budget and track your expenses to ensure you're making the most of your money. * Invest your savings in a high-yield savings account or a diversified portfolio, which can help your money grow even faster.

By following these steps, you can turn your everyday expenses into a significant source of savings. And with a little discipline, patience, and persistence, you'll be well on your way to achieving your travel goals.
